Corporate Compliance Officer - Healthcare jobs in New Mexico

Corporate Compliance Officer - Healthcare is responsible for programs, policies, and practices that ensure that all departments are in compliance with JCAHO, HIPAA, and accreditation standards. Monitors compliance with federal, state, and local regulatory requirements. Being a Corporate Compliance Officer - Healthcare stays abreast of laws and regulations that might affect the organization's policies and procedures. Prepares compliance reports to present to senior management. Additionally, Corporate Compliance Officer - Healthcare requires a bachelor's degree in a related area. Typically reports to a head of a unit/department. To be a Corporate Compliance Officer - Healthcare typically requires 4 to 7 years of related experience. Cont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. Work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Court Compliance Officer
  • Sandoval County
  • Bernalillo, NM OTHER
  • Under general supervision, performs case management, tracks and monitors offender's compliance of court orders, which have been adjudicated of misdemeanor and felony crimes; and performs other related duties as assigned

    • Associates Degree in Criminal Justice, Counseling, or related field;
    • Two years of experience in counseling in the judiciary, criminal justice, or other human services discipline that involves tracking and monitoring offender compliance, case management, conducting client appointments and substance abuse testing, and documenting and maintaining files; OR an equivalent combination of education and experience.
    Required Licenses or Certifications:
    • Valid New Mexico Driver’s License
    • Completion of Interstate Compact Training (ICT) within six months of hire
    • Completion of National Crime Information Center (NCIC) certification training within six months of hire
    • Completion of Court Officer Basic Training (COBT)  within one year of hire
    • Completion of Mental Health First Aid Training (MHFAT)  within one year of hire
    • Completion of Court Officer Advanced Training (COAT)  within two years of hire
    • Other licenses and certifications as required within a specified time period after hire
    • Per Administrative Office of the Courts (AOC) guidelines, must obtain a minimum of 16 CEU’s per year in training that is in the related field of criminal justice.
    Additional Requirements:
    • Must pass an FBI (III) background check
    • This position is subject to random alcohol and drug testing in accordance with Sandoval County Personnel rules and Regulations Article XIII Drug and Alcohol Policy and Testing-Drug Free Workplace. 
    • Conducts daily client probation appointments, which includes urinalysis and breathalyzer testing, updating telephone and address changes; advises clients of upcoming deadlines; monitors compliance with treatment; receives payments; makes probation progress notes; and schedules monthly probation appointments.
    • Completes a variety of paperwork and reports including positive urinalysis reports, notice of court appearance, completion of community service ignition interlock reports, treatment compliance and noncompliance, certificates of completion such as DWI school, Victims Impact Panel, completion of community service, donations, restitution, and requesting court documents.
    • Makes weekly court appearances and provides testimony of violations and clients progress in the program and presents oral and written recommendations.
    • Communicates daily with the public, law enforcement, ADA’s office, and outside treatment agencies to respond to inquiries and questions and provide information via telephone, voice message, e-mail and written correspondence; attends a variety of meetings including staff meetings, committee meetings and other special meetings to exchange information, network, and discuss relevant issues and concerns; attends training sessions to maintain knowledge and skills related to work performed.
    • Maintains current knowledge of and compliance with all 121 Accreditation Standards for the Adult Misdemeanor Compliance Program.
    • Files Non-compliance and/or Probation Violations as needed to keep offenders in compliance.
    • Enters all pertinent information into ADE and Caseload Pro databases including all notes in an accurate and timely manner.
    • Travels to various locations within Sandoval County including tribal courts, Bernalillo Magistrate Court, Rio Rancho Municipal Court and Cuba Magistrate Court. 
    • Tracks felony offenders for Adult Probation and Parole Office.
    • Attends quarterly Ad Hoc Compliance Meetings in various locations in New Mexico.
    • Performs other job related duties as assigned.

New Mexico (Spanish: Nuevo México Spanish pronunciation: [ˈnweβo ˈmexiko] (listen), Navajo: Yootó Hahoodzo pronounced [jòːtxó xɑ̀xʷòːtsò]) is a state in the Southwestern region of the United States of America; its capital and cultural center is Santa Fe, which was founded in 1610 as capital of Nuevo México (itself established as a province of New Spain in 1598), while its largest city is Albuquerque with its accompanying metropolitan area. It is one of the Mountain States and shares the Four Corners region with Utah, Colorado, and Arizona; its other neighboring states are Oklahoma to the north...
